How do you go from being a professional oboist and music teacher to owning a jet company?

Fasten your seatbelts, because Denise Wilson’s entrepreneurial dream has taken flight… and Glambition Radio is taking you along for the ride!

Denise is the CEO of Desert Jet, an aircraft charter company that she founded in 2007. Desert Jet offers on-demand jet charters through its fleet of aircraft based in Palm Springs, California.

Denise led Desert Jet’s growth as one of the nation’s fastest growing, privately-owned companies, ranking the last three years on the Inc. 500 list with a growth rate of over 600%!

Denise and I are both in the Ernst & Young Winning Women program, and became friends at an EY event last year where we met.

Back when she was falling in love with flying and building her business from scratch, Denise’s husband AND her best friend told her she was crazy… that no one wanted to see a woman flying them around in a private jet. (Only 6% of all pilots are women.) Here’s the kicker: Now her husband works for her! 😉

Tip #1: Don’t listen to your critics

“Don’t ever let anyone deter you. If you have a vision and you know that you’ve worked the numbers, you know your target market, you know all the details behind it… don’t let anyone tell you that you can’t do it, or there’s a reason why you can’t be successful in what you want to do.”

Tip #2: Just say “YES”… and figure out the details later  

“If you’re given an opportunity, and you’re not quite sure that you can execute or deliver, just say ‘Yes’—especially if it’s an opportunity that you want. Just say ‘Yes’ and then figure out later how you’re going to get it done!”

Tip #3: Market yourself as “the expert” 

“When you’re first starting out, what really worked for me was marketing myself as the expert. I wrote a lot of content on aviation, and I was able to be seen with credibility right from the get-go when I started my company… instead of having to have a time period where I had to prove myself.”
